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5953139198 13 3489261268 39596461391
68926 203999733
68926 203999733
3378022670 9984 16155050
All about undefined
Interested in learning more?
68926 203999733
3378022670 9984 16155050
See more
07628870278 965664
848444 57060481677 35
See more
28327856112 449893
4561 71366 549799 951 787
See more